Cameroonian artists conducted a peaceful protest on April 2, 2025, in front of the Prime Minister's office in Yaoundé, demanding payment of overdue copyright royalties from the government. This marks the second consecutive day of demonstrations by the artistic community seeking resolution of financial grievances.
